Arnab Goswami arrested by Mumbai Police, news anchor reveals he was assaulted and his son beaten up

Arnab Goswami has been arrested in the abetment of suicide case of 2018, which was closed earlier but now has been reopened.

After numerous FIRs against Republic TV journalist and Chief Editor, Arnab Goswami, being filed, he has been finally arrested by the Mumbai Police. On Wednesday morning, i.e. 4th November, the Raigad unit of Mumbai Police raided the Worli residence of the owner of Republic TV and has reportedly arrested Arnab Goswami in an Abetment to Suicide case of a 53-year old interior designer, Anvay Naik and his mother, Kumud Naik.

A senior Police officer, Sachin Vaze, reported that Goswami has been arrested in relation to abetment to suicide case of 2018, which has been reopened now. It was also confirmed by another police officer that Arnab Goswami has been taken to Alibaug. It was also reported that the family members of the Editor protested against the arrest when a team of officers went ahead to arrest him. During the raid, a team of Crime branch, as well as CID, was also present at the spot.

The channel, in the defence of its Chief Editor, called out the arrest to be “a move for parading the editor of a top Indian news channel like a criminal, pulled by the hair, threatened, not allowed to drink water.” However, Arnab was able to speak to the media personnel from the vehicle he was kept in and he said that he was assaulted and his son was beaten by the police. Whilst all this was happening, Goswami’s colleagues made direct “emotional” appeal to the Supreme Court for justice.
